I am glad to hear you are happy with your engine and car as it is! Thats enough isnt it, no matter what other people think of it. However, you should be aware of the fact that the reason for the lack of aftermarket tuning parts for this engine is that it simply cant cope with it. A huge amount of power can not be extracted from this engine, at least not with out a lot of mods to both internals and external parts. This is a well known fact. There is probably some small capacity left, but dont expect any power increase like in the 4cyl cars. Sorry!
